Fuzzy Operation (Add, subtract, multiply, and divide) without using the built-in matlab function?
显示 更早的评论
I'm trying to do the fuzzy operations of 2 specific functions f1 and f2 where
f1 = gaussmf(x, [2 2]); f2 = gaussmf(x, [3 6]);
since fuzzy addition has x-values from the lower and upper limits of x from two functions [a,b]+[d,e] = [a+d, b+e]
I have to do this for 100 y-values from 0 to 1.
